§ 12 §6535 — Sea urchin and scallop diving tender license
1.License required.
A person may not act as a diving tender on a boat engaged as a platform for the harvesting of sea urchins and scallops by hand unless that person is licensed under this section.
2.Licensed activity.
A person licensed under this section may tend divers who harvest sea urchins and scallops by hand and operate a boat as a platform for the harvesting of sea urchins and scallops by hand. A sea urchin and scallop diving tender license does not authorize the holder to harvest sea urchins and scallops. As used in this subsection, "tend" means to assist the diver in any way, to operate a boat as a platform for harvesting or to cull or otherwise handle the harvested product.
